Clara Oswald

Clara Oswald is a fictional character created by Steven Moffat and portrayed by Jenna Coleman in the long-running British science fiction television series ''Doctor Who''.
First appearing in the show's seventh series, Clara served as a companion of the eleventh incarnation of the alien time traveller known as the Doctor (portrayed by Matt Smith).
Clara is initially presented to the audience during the first half of Series 7 as three distinct, though similarly named, people living in different eras of time. The first two incarnations, Oswin Oswald and Clara Oswin Oswald, die during the episode in which they appear. The third incarnation becomes the Doctor's companion, travelling with him for the remainder of the series as he tries to uncover the mystery of her multiple lives. The mystery is later resolved in "The Name of the Doctor" (2013). She continued to travel with the Doctor, witnessing him regenerate into his Twelfth incarnation played by Scottish actor Peter Capaldi at the end of "The Time of the Doctor". They continued to have various adventures together in Series 8 and Series 9.
